(*) The Jews divided the old Testament into io three parts, the Books of Moses, which they called the Law. The Prophets. And under the Psalms they comprehended the Psalms of David, the writings of Solomon, and Job, which are * iul" commonly called the Hagiographa, that is holy Writings.
